Ticket #— Floor 9 Opening Prep, Brindlemoor House

Hi facilities folks, Floor 9 opens to staff next Monday and we need a few things squared away before then. Lift access is live, but the two side doors by the kitchenette are still on the old lock config — please reprogram them before Friday. Also, signage for the quiet rooms hasn't arrived, so pop up the temporary printed ones for now. Until the badge readers sync, the interim door code for Floor 9 is below.

door code, bajop-bajog: bdg-DSWAC-43621

Step 4 — Shipping the TaxPeek cache refresh

Once the rate tables are warmed, you'll push the cache snapshot to the Lorvane staging bucket. The uploader won't accept anything unsigned, so don't skip this bit — it'll just bounce your snapshot silently. Grab the signer CLI from the tools repo, then register the deploy key shown below.

release key, hadug-kawef: bky13_mPGeFZeR1GZ1G

TICKET #OPS-882 — Cron drift investigation stuck: vault locked itself again

Hey, quick one before you review my branch. I was digging into why the Tumblestone nightly jobs drift ~40s per week, and the evidence I need (historical scheduler snapshots) lives in the Coldharbor vault, which sealed itself after the host reboot. My fix PR adjusts the tick source, but I can't validate against real snapshots until it's open. Reviewer or whoever gets here first: unseal it with the recovery passphrase directly below.

recovery phrase for kawep-kawep: caseth-gorael-quenmir-olieth-ulavan-fenwyn-eliix-fraox-zorok

Handover for on-call: Torvane firmware channel

Hey — the "stable" device-firmware update channel is frozen until Grenholt's rollout finishes Monday. If a device bricks, push the rollback image from the beta channel; it's safe. The signing vault re-locked after the freeze, so you'll need the recovery passphrase, which I've left below.

vault phrase of bagaf-kajeg = jorath-feniel-briir-siliel-ralix